## Tuning pagination

The Wrenfield public API paginates everything with cursor tokens, and the defaults are deliberately conservative. If a partner complains about slow list endpoints, resist bumping page sizes first — check whether they're walking cursors serially. Oversized pages hammer the read replicas and show up as tail latency for everyone. When you do need to adjust, the knobs live here.

constants for bawif-kawif:
QUOTAS = {
    "ulaael": 5,
    "holael": 10,
}

Runbook: Lanternfield rate-parity checker. If parity alerts spike overnight, it's almost always the Dovecrest feed sending stale rates — check the fetch timestamps before panicking. Restart the comparator worker, wait one full poll cycle, and confirm deltas drop under threshold. If they do, log the recovery in the channel. Grab the token from the healthy run and paste it below.

session token of tajef-bageg = htk21_5d90d574934f3ccae6437

Action item from the Givebright incident: fix the donation-receipt mailer. Root cause: the receipt template renderer silently dropped sends when the donor's locale was unset, so roughly 4% of donors got no receipt for three days. Fix shipped; backfill of missed receipts runs nightly this week. Support: if a donor reports a missing receipt, confirm the donation date falls in the gap window before escalating. Canned replies and the backfill status tracker are on the internal page.

runbook for badug-kadup: https://confluence.zemvarlabs.internal/projects/browse/display/projects/bd1b